Transaction 82689f9f07a02bfa4223f039808e37474f75ab77235d5b956a0467508a18c21a
1 Input
2 Outputs
- 82689f9f07a02bfa4223f039808e37474f75ab77235d5b956a0467508a18c21a:0
- 82689f9f07a02bfa4223f039808e37474f75ab77235d5b956a0467508a18c21a:1
value 481004
address 14q3x13h66ZwBpsrATgGWuvP9aRSRYoMry
value 3400000
address 3K62NXBfLtarKX6sNfqPgYeungDNf2gxub